I had one two years ago and sold it for a Tri axis. It came with 4X Match top 3’s and a spare no.4 section. With the no.1 section removed it will be ok to use with black hydro. It was ok to fish upto 14m and heavy at 16m but it’s not as stiff as a lot of poles at 14m.
